1. A nurse has unintentionally given an incor- D
rect dose of medication to their client. No
harm was done to the client. What is the next
action, if any, required by the nurse?
A. The nurse is not required to report the
mistake because the client was not harmed
B. The nurse is not responsible for the mis-
take because they have not been provided
current education by their employer
C. The nurse will immediately be suspended
and their license will be revoked
D. The nurse will report the incident to their
nurse manager and follow their organiza-
tional procedures for reporting

3. A Bosnian Muslim woman who doesn't A
speak English seeks care at a community
care clinic. Through physical gestures, the
woman indicates that she has pain originat-
ing in either the pelvic or genital region.
Assuming several people are available to in-
terpret, who would be the most appropriate
choice?
A. A female interpreter who doesn't know
the client
B. A female neighbor of the client who is also
from Bosnia
C. The client's adult daughter
D. A Bosnian male, who is a certified medical
interpreter
